Output 6f3da87980918ba5f0fd8a553facb9c2d6d1dbfb0bb8389ec2abe07e29b103cf:4

value
224083
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b40ce046ecf1ab5c8d93a2fed509a8df63291e03 OP_EQUAL
address
3J72yifL9fubHqyXecDqqL7NFJgdpLnTWk
transaction
6f3da87980918ba5f0fd8a553facb9c2d6d1dbfb0bb8389ec2abe07e29b103cf
confirmations
185456
spent
true